Ghulam Nabi Azad Advocates for Early Assembly Elections in J&K
Ghulam Nabi Azad, former J&K Chief Minister and chairman of the Democratic Azad Party (DAP), has called for the early conduct of Assembly elections in Jammu and Kashmir, emphasizing the irreplaceable value of electoral democracy.
Speaking at a large public rally in Neel village of the Banihal constituency, Azad stressed that governance should be in the hands of people’s representatives rather than bureaucrats. He asserted that the people’s faith in electoral democracy is unparalleled, and their representatives are more accessible for addressing local issues.
Azad outlined his vision for Banihal, promising to transform it into an economic powerhouse of Jammu and Kashmir. He highlighted his previous contributions to the region’s development, including building hospitals, roads, and colleges, and plans to further boost the local economy through tourism and agriculture.
Commitment to Socio-Economic Development
The DAP leader expressed his commitment to the overall socio-economic development of Banihal, which he holds dear. He plans to make Banihal a prominent tourist hub, thereby enhancing the local economy. Additionally, he promised the establishment of more colleges and hospitals to improve healthcare accessibility and educational standards in the area.

Azad emphasized the importance of providing quality education and healthcare to the people of Banihal. He aims to enable the youth to compete at national and international levels and assures the implementation of development projects without compromising quality standards.
Criticism of Other Political Parties
Concluding his speech, Azad criticized other political parties for exploiting the people of Banihal. He expressed confidence that the people would reject these parties in the upcoming elections, reaffirming his commitment to the region’s development and welfare.
